Fix a screen that isn't working right on Android

Attempt the solutions below if your phone screen:

  • Doesn't reply
  • Flickers
  • Jumps
  • Flashes
  • Shows dead pixels
  • Stays blank

Step one: Cheque your phone's screen

Important:Afterwards you effort each recommended solution, check to find whether information technology fixed your issue.

  1. Brand sure that your screen isn't cracked, chipped, or damaged.
  2. If you take a case or screen protector, take it off.
  3. If you're wearing gloves, take them off.
  4. If you've put any stickers over the screen or sensors, peel them off.
  5. Make certain that your screen is clean.

Pace two: Endeavour these troubleshooting steps

Restart your telephone

  1. On most phones, press your phone's power button for about 30 seconds, or until your phone restarts.
  2. On the screen, you might need to tap Restart.

Tip:After you restart, if your touchscreen is still completely unresponsive, learn how to reset your telephone to manufacturing plant settings (below).

Find out whether an app causes your problem

Of import: To learn how to turn condom manner on and off, go to your device manufacturer's support site.

  1. Turn on safe mode.
  2. Affect the screen.
    • If the screen works in safe manner, an app is most likely causing your issue.
  3. Turn off prophylactic way.
  4. To find the app that causes issues, uninstall recently downloaded apps ane by 1. After you lot remove the app that causes the problem, you can reinstall the other apps you removed.

Exam the affected role of your screen

  1. Touch the elevation left corner of the screen.
  2. Slowly drag your finger to the bottom correct corner without lifting. Try to move your finger slowly enough that yous can count to 10 before reaching the opposite corner of the screen.Drag your finger across the screen image
    • If you can drag your Quick Settings bar and notifications all the way to the bottom of the screen
      The problem isn't caused by a specific surface area on your screen. Larn how to reset your phone to factory settings (below).
    • If your Quick Settings bar and notifications release while you're all the same dragging your finger across the screen
      Repeat the exam. If they release again, annotation whether it happened in the aforementioned place on the screen. Then contact your device manufacturer.

Turn off programmer options

  1. Open your telephone'south Settings app.
  2. Tap OrganisationAnd thenProgrammer options. You'll see this just if you take programmer options turned on.
  3. Plow off Developer options.
